My wife has a 2004 Megane II 1.5 diesel Dynamic. We have a water leak in the passenger side, door pocket that can have 1 or 2 inches of rain water in it. We have tried to trace where the leak is coming from and wonder if the mirror is allowing the water in. (We have electric mirrors on the car)
We do not suffer with water in the foot well but need to sponge the water out regularly from the pocket.

I tried the speaker solution with no luck
So I got myself a sheet of plastic and placed it between the door and panel and cutting out sections for wires etc then gaffa taped all edges and made sure that the drain for the door was clear so water can flow out (bottom front of door a small hole)
Now I just need to sort out water in floor compartment lol
